Introduction

The global orthopedic soft tissue repair market refers to the healthcare segment that focuses on repairing, reconstructing and regenerating soft tissues that sustain damage throughout the human body. The market comprises various products, which include sutures, suture anchors, meshes, grafts and fixation devices that orthopedic surgeons use during surgical procedures. The market experiences rapid growth because more people develop sports injuries and trauma cases, and age-related musculoskeletal disorders. The market shows expansion because more people want to use minimally invasive surgical methods, and scientists develop better biomaterials and regenerative medicine solutions. The field of tissue engineering, together with biologics and bio-absorbable implant innovations, has succeeded in enhancing healing results while decreasing the duration until patients recover. The market shows expansion because more elderly people exist, more people participate in sports and global healthcare spending increases. The global market for advanced soft tissue repair solutions receives support through better healthcare facilities and increased public knowledge about orthopedic treatment methods.

  1. Rising Adoption of Minimally Invasive Surgeries

The orthopedic soft tissue repair market is experiencing a major trend of minimally invasive surgeries because they provide multiple advantages, which include decreased patient trauma, shorter hospital stays and faster recovery periods. The procedures require small incisions, which enable surgeons to use advanced surgical instruments that include arthroscopes and specialized repair devices. Surgeons prefer these techniques for ligament, tendon, and cartilage repairs because they provide higher precision and lower complication rates. The procedures allow patients to experience reduced pain after surgery while achieving quicker recovery to their regular daily activities. The global adoption of minimally invasive orthopedic soft tissue repair techniques is increasing because of patients needing outpatient procedures and medical facilities developing better surgical technologies.

  1. Advancements in Biomaterials and Tissue Engineering

The orthopedic soft tissue repair market experiences transformation through biomaterials and tissue engineering innovations, which deliver better healing results and extended patient wellness. The use of bioresorbable polymers together with collagen-based scaffolds and synthetic grafts helps to improve tissue regeneration processes. Tissue engineering uses a combination of cells and scaffolds, plus growth factors, to improve the process of repairing ligaments and tendons that have sustained injuries. These advancements decrease the chances of rejection while they enhance the body's ability to connect with artificial tissues. The research institutions, together with medical companies, are making substantial financial commitments to create future medical repair technologies. Patients who undergo orthopedic surgeries with soft tissue repair experience quicker healing times and fewer complications, along with better movement abilities.

 

  1. Increasing Use of Bio-absorbable Implants

Bio-absorbable implants are gaining popularity in orthopedic soft tissue repair because they dissolve naturally within the body, which results in complete dissolution of the implant without needing further surgical extraction. The implants contain polylactic acid and polyglycolic acid materials that promote tissue healing while their components develop into complete dissolution over time. The medical field uses these devices for ligament fixation, tendon repair and bone-related surgical operations. The implants attract surgeon preference because they decrease operational problems while boosting patient satisfaction. The trend is driven by increasing interest in surgical methods that enhance patient experience, together with advancements in biodegradable material technologies. This innovation brings major improvements to recovery times while also bringing decreased chances of medical complications that last for extended periods.

 

  1. Expansion of Regenerative Medicine Applications

Regenerative medicine plays a vital role in orthopedic soft tissue repair by enhancing the body's natural healing mechanisms. Medical professionals now use stem cell therapy and platelet-rich plasma (PRP) injections and growth factor-based treatments as standard methods to treat tissue damage. The therapies provide better results for ligament, tendon, and cartilage regeneration than regular treatment methods. Hospitals and research centers are using regenerative methods together with surgical techniques to achieve better results. The increasing success of clinical trials and the continuous progress in research are driving worldwide adoption of this technology. This trend is transforming orthopedic treatment by enabling patients to recover faster while experiencing less discomfort and achieving better long-term joint results.

  1. Arthrex, Inc.

Headquarters: Naples, Florida, USA

Arthrex, Inc. is a leading global manufacturer of orthopedic soft tissue repair products, specializing in minimally invasive surgical solutions. The company offers a wide range of products, which include suture anchors, arthroscopy instruments and fixation systems that medical professionals use to repair ligament, tendon and cartilage injuries. Arthrex is known for its strong focus on research and innovation because the company develops new technologies that help doctors achieve better surgical results and patients achieve faster recovery times. Its products are widely used in sports medicine and orthopedic procedures around the globe. Arthrex advances modern orthopedic soft tissue repair techniques through its extensive global distribution network and dedication to educational programs and training initiatives.
